I have just been tinkering out the back with the counterweights off and attempting some sort of polar alignment. I found that the what I was looking at was quite a bit lower than where the SCP should be.
Now I have made an assumption that the telescope should be parallel to the polar axis of the mount and if I place an inclinometer on the scope after the mount has been levelled, it should measure the same as the latitude marker on the mount.
Well I had to raise the latitude to just on 25 degrees to level the scope. So either the level bubble in the mount base is out or the latitude marker scale has moved.
